About Dr Raza

Dr Razaullah Khan is a General Practitioner with over nine years of clinical experience across primary care and emergency medicine in Ireland, Pakistan and Saudi Arabia — bringing a breadth of international clinical exposure and adaptability to diverse healthcare systems that enriches his approach to primary care. He is registered with the Irish Medical Council and has held full medical registration in both Pakistan and Saudi Arabia. His career spans high-volume emergency department work, out-of-hours primary care services and GP practice, giving him particular strength in the rapid assessment of urgent presentations, early identification of red-flag symptoms and appropriate referral when required. Dr Khan has extensive hands-on procedural experience including wound suturing, abscess drainage, foreign body removal, nail procedures and basic fracture management with splinting and casting — a level of practical clinical skill that is uncommon in online GP practice and that gives him a grounded, confident approach to acute presentations. He holds current certification in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) and Basic Life Support (BLS) from the American Heart Association. Dr Khan consults in English, Urdu, Arabic, Pashto and Punjabi — making him one of the most linguistically accessible GPs in Ireland, and one of the very few Irish-registered doctors who can consult in Pashto. For patients from Afghan, Pakistani, Arabic-speaking and South Asian communities in Ireland, this represents access to a fully qualified GP in their first language. Medical disclaimer. All services are provided at GP level in accordance with Irish healthcare regulations. Prescriptions, referrals, and medical certificates may be issued only when clinically appropriate and at the doctor's discretion. Our doctors do not routinely prescribe controlled substances through online consultations. Electronic sick leave certificates are not accepted by the Department of Social Protection in Ireland. Backdated sick notes are not routinely issued due to the lack of a direct clinical assessment at the time of illness.
